Alonso: Chelsea can be built around attacking trio

Chelsea defeated Fulham 3-2 in a Premier League London derby. After his debut league win, Blues coach Xabi Alonso highlighted the roles of Joao Pedro, Morgan Rogers and Cole Palmer. According to Channel NewsAsia, citing Reuters, the Spanish specialist said the team can be built around this attacking trio.

According to Alonso, the footballers must take responsibility, lead their teammates and inspire the rest of the team with their play.

Goals by Pedro, Rogers and Palmer

Joao Pedro opened the scoring after just 31 seconds, converting a pass from Palmer. In the 41st minute, Morgan Rogers restored Chelsea’s lead by scoring in his debut match for the club after joining from Aston Villa. The source describes the transfer as a record one for Chelsea.

At the start of the second half, Pedro assisted Palmer, who made it 3-1 for the visitors with an angled shot between the legs of Fulham goalkeeper Bernd Leno.

Fulham retained their chances

Fulham responded with goals from Josh King and Gonzalo Garcia and kept the contest alive until the final whistle. Antonee Robinson could have equalised, but missed Robert Sanchez’s goal while trying to chip the goalkeeper.

Chelsea had 18 shots, six of them on target. Alonso also praised Palmer for his dynamic and free play. Palmer had injury problems last season, while Chelsea finished the championship in 10th place.

Fulham coach Alvaro Arbeloa noted that the early conceded goal made the task more difficult for his team. At the same time, he praised the players for following the plan with energetic high pressing and said the team would play in this style regardless of the opponent.
